What is a crystal tree in Vastu?
A crystal tree is a small decorative tree whose leaves are made from tumbled crystal chips, usually set on wire branches with a crystal or cement base. In Vastu and crystal therapy it is used as a gentle energy object, placed in the zone that relates to the quality you want to support.
The tree shape itself carries meaning. Trees symbolise growth, rootedness and steady expansion, so a crystal tree is often chosen for new beginnings — a new home, a new business, a child starting college. Because it is portable, it suits rented flats and offices where structural changes are not possible.

Which crystal tree suits which direction?
Each crystal suits a particular direction because Vastu links each direction with a deity, an element and an area of life. Matching the crystal's qualities to the zone is the heart of crystal tree Vastu.
01
North — Citrine or Green Aventurine
The North is the zone of Kubera and new opportunities. Citrine is associated with abundance and positivity; Green Aventurine with growth and career.
02
North-East — Amethyst or Clear Quartz
ईशान्य (Ishanya, the North-East) is linked with water, clarity and spiritual calm. Amethyst and Clear Quartz support a peaceful, reflective feeling.
03
East — Green Aventurine or Clear Quartz
The East, associated with Indra and the rising sun, supports health, fresh starts and social connections.
04
South-West — Rose Quartz
The South-West is the earth zone of stability and relationships. A Rose Quartz tree is often chosen for harmony between partners.
05
South-East — Red Jasper or Carnelian
The fire zone of Agni relates to energy and cash flow. Warm-toned crystals are sometimes used here, kept away from the stove.

What are crystal balls used for in Vastu?
Crystal balls are used in Vastu to gather and spread balanced energy evenly in a space. The round shape has no sharp edges, so it is associated with harmony, completeness and smooth movement of energy.
A Clear Quartz ball is the most versatile choice. It is often placed in the North-East of the home or on a centre table in the living room, where it can catch natural light. A Rose Quartz ball suits the South-West bedroom, and an Amethyst ball can be kept in a study or meditation corner.
You may also see faceted glass balls hung in windows to scatter rainbows of light. That idea is more closely associated with Feng Shui, which is a separate tradition. In Vastu, natural crystals are generally preferred.

Where should you avoid placing a crystal tree or ball?
Avoid placing crystal trees or balls in toilets, under staircases, on the floor or inside cluttered cupboards. Crystals are treated as energy objects, so they should be kept somewhere clean, visible and respected.
01
Not in bathrooms
Toilets are zones of release and disposal, not places to amplify energy.
02
Not facing the bed directly
A large, sparkling ball directly in line with the bed may feel stimulating. Keep bedroom crystals to the side.
03
Not in harsh afternoon sun
Some crystals, including Amethyst and Rose Quartz, may fade with long exposure to strong sunlight. Also avoid focusing sunlight through a clear ball onto fabric or paper.
04
Not in the centre of the floor
Keep the Brahmasthan (centre) open. A small ball on a centre table is fine; heavy displays in the middle of the floor are not.

How do you cleanse and activate a crystal tree?
Cleanse a crystal tree before first use and then regularly, using methods that do not harm the wire and base. At VastuKimaya, crystals are cleansed with salt, sunlight or sound and then activated with Reiki and Vedic mantras before placement.
01
Sound
Ring a bell or singing bowl near the tree for a minute. This is safe for every type of crystal tree.
02
Salt nearby
Place the tree beside a bowl of rock salt overnight rather than burying it, as salt can corrode the wires.
03
Gentle morning light
A short time in soft early sunlight suits many crystals. Avoid strong midday sun for colour-sensitive stones.
04
Set an intention
Hold the tree, breathe slowly and think clearly about what you hope the space will feel like.

Can you keep a crystal tree in the office?
Yes, a crystal tree can be kept in the office, and it is one of the simplest portable remedies for a workplace. A Citrine or Green Aventurine tree in the North of the office or reception supports a sense of opportunity and growth.
On a personal desk, a small Clear Quartz or Amethyst tree on the North-East side of the desk can support calm focus. Keep it dusted, and replace it if the chips fall off or the tree looks tired — a neglected crystal sends the opposite message to the one you intend.
07
Are crystal trees a substitute for correcting Vastu defects?
Crystal trees are a supportive remedy, not a complete substitute for correcting significant Vastu defects. They work well for fine-tuning a zone or bringing a positive intention into a room.
A toilet in the North-East, a kitchen in the North-East or a heavy centre usually needs a combined approach — for example pyramids, metal strips, colour correction and crystals together. Crystal therapy complements Vastu and Reiki; it is part of a larger plan rather than a single answer. It also does not replace medical care for any health concern.
